Blue skies over Foxford yet again today and it looks like it will continue for the next while. Apart from those who are here on holidays the river banks are deserted. It’s a difficult period for salmon angling, thankfully there are alternatives although this bright weather is also having an effect on trout fishing. We can do nothing except grin and bear it, grab a few hours early morning and late evening.
